I've played with the hounds tooth trend by adding a pair of brogues in this pattern, pairing them with patterned dotty pop sox. I am unrepentant about my passion for pop sox (as long as they're only worn with trousers and not skirts).
Chunky pearls and a leopard print clutch finish off the look. Oh, and some red lippy. The shirt comes up quite big: with hindsight I would have gone down a size, because the tie waist could have had a bit more emphasis had there not been so much fabric. I wore a camisole underneath, which you can't see, but when I wore the outfit to work it was a good call because during the day the ties became looser and the camisole preserved my dignity.
